Contents |
Forging a civil rights-labor alliance in the shadow of the Cold War -- Standing at the crossroads : race, labor, war, and poverty -- Down Jericho road : the poor people's campaign and Memphis strike -- Epilogue : King and labor. |
|
CD: "The unresolved race question," District 65 Thirtieth-Anniversary Convention, Madison Square Garden, New York City, Oct. 23, 1963 -- "All labor has dignity," Mason Temple Mass Meeting, Memphis, Tenn., Mar. 18, 1968. |
Summary |
Contains speeches by civil rights leader Dr. Martin Luther King, Jr., on the topic of economic justice, and includes an audio CD. |
